Output de8e617e20632216501c31d4c5839315a489b2fcfe571b6f337ab4add398167c:7

value
848484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b91c6cf1891451e0d4f8f35bad6391079dae1cb OP_EQUAL
address
3QdCARpanznjGJaotw6gJwp6YvnSDv4L4B
transaction
de8e617e20632216501c31d4c5839315a489b2fcfe571b6f337ab4add398167c
confirmations
108088
spent
true